low-ranked

[US]/[ˈləʊˌrænkt]/
[UK]/[ˈloʊˌrænkt]/
Frequency: Very High

Translation

adj.Having a low position or status; inferior in rank.; Not highly regarded; mediocre.
n.A person or thing of low rank.
